# Artifact Signing — Bouncewright Processor

All Bouncewright releases are signed before the bounce-processor workers will load them. Support: if a customer reports rejected deploys, verify they pulled the latest bundle, not a mirror copy. Unsigned or stale artifacts fail closed; the worker logs a SIGFAIL line. Do not advise disabling verification. Escalate to the Relay Crew if the signature is valid but rejected. Verify against the current signing key below.

rollout seal: bky4_DFM9

Quick context for review: Spindlecast's websocket layer now supports permessage compression, but it's a tradeoff — small chat-style frames compress poorly and burn CPU, while the bulk sync frames shrink by 60%+. So we gate compression on frame size and negotiate window bits down on memory-constrained pods. Sliding-window memory per connection is the real cost at scale, which is why the defaults are conservative. The thresholds we landed on are below.

constants for fafof-yadug:
QUOTAS = {
    "gorael": 575,
    "kasok": 31,
}

## Changelog — Fennelworks Migrator 4.2

Changed defaults: zero-downtime schema migrations are now the standard path. Online column backfills run in batches, and lock timeouts abort rather than queue. Plugin authors relying on the old blocking behavior must opt in explicitly via their manifest. The new default migration settings shipped with 4.2 are listed below.

service settings:
[quenath]
host = quenath.zemvarcorp.corp
user = quenath_svc
database = quenath_prod

Subject: Contractor week one — access

All new starters: Marek Voss from Brindlewood Systems is on site this week fitting out the Larkspur meeting rooms. Do not let him tailgate through the east stairwell; he signs in at the desk each morning like everyone else. His work area is cordoned off — keep clear. If he needs escorting to the loading bay, call the desk first. Use the temporary pass code below until Friday.

door code, yagap-bahof: bdg-O-05